Overview of Legal Translation Services

Legal translation services involve the specialized translation of legal documents and materials, ensuring that the meaning and intent of the original text are preserved across different languages. These services are crucial in a globalized world where legal matters often cross borders, impacting various sectors such as business, immigration, and international law. With the rise of global commerce and multicultural societies, the demand for precise legal translations continues to grow, underscoring the significance of this field in facilitating communication and understanding among different legal systems.Accuracy and confidentiality are paramount in legal translations, as even minor errors can lead to significant legal repercussions.

Legal documents often contain complex terminology that requires a deep understanding of both the source and target languages, as well as the legal systems involved. Additionally, the sensitive nature of legal documents necessitates a high level of confidentiality to protect the information of all parties involved. This need for precision and discretion makes legal translation a specialized field that demands trained professionals who are fluent in both the language and the legal context.

Key Industries Relying on Legal Translation Services

Several key industries rely heavily on legal translation services to ensure compliance and effective communication across different languages and jurisdictions. Understanding these industries helps highlight the essential role of legal translators.

  • Corporate Sector: Multinational corporations frequently engage in transactions, contracts, and negotiations that require legal documents to be translated accurately. For instance, a company expanding into a new market must translate its terms of service, employment contracts, and compliance documents to meet local legal requirements.
  • Immigration Services: Legal translation is critical in immigration processes, where individuals must provide translated documentation such as birth certificates, marriage licenses, and legal affidavits. The accuracy of these translations can significantly affect the outcome of immigration applications.
  • Legal Firms: Law firms dealing with international cases often require legal translators to assist in the translation of case documents, briefs, and contracts, ensuring that all parties understand the legal implications and proceedings.
  • Healthcare Sector: In the healthcare industry, legal translation is vital for patient documentation, informed consent forms, and insurance contracts, ensuring compliance with local laws and regulations.
  • Real Estate: The real estate sector also benefits from legal translation services, particularly in property transactions that involve foreign buyers or sellers, requiring accurate translations of contracts, deeds, and property agreements.

Employment and Work-Related Documents

In the realm of employment, legal translation services are indispensable for translating contracts, employee handbooks, and policy manuals. These documents must be precise to prevent misunderstandings that could lead to costly disputes. Accurate legal translation allows multinational companies to standardize employment practices while respecting local laws. For instance:

  • Employment contracts for international employees are translated to ensure compliance with both the home and host country’s labor laws.
  • Employee handbooks provide guidelines on workplace conduct and benefits, necessitating translation for clarity across diverse employee backgrounds.

Management Agreements and Corporate Governance

Legal translation is vital in crafting management agreements and facilitating corporate governance. These documents often involve intricate legal language and must adhere to specific regulatory requirements. Effective translation ensures that all parties fully understand their rights and obligations, fostering transparency and trust. Examples include:

  • Shareholder agreements that Artikel the roles and responsibilities of stakeholders in different jurisdictions.
  • Board resolutions and minutes that must be accessible in multiple languages to align with global corporate governance standards.

Publishing and Printing Media

In the publishing industry, legal translation services are critical for handling contracts and protecting intellectual property rights. Publishers often deal with literary contracts, copyright agreements, and licensing deals that require precise language to avoid legal ambiguities. Notable applications include:

  • Contracts for translation rights in which an author grants permission to translate their work into another language.
  • Copyright agreements that ensure the protection of creative works across different legal systems.

Telecommunications Sector

The telecommunications sector heavily relies on legal translation for compliance with international regulations and standards. Accurate translation is essential for contracts, service agreements, and regulatory submissions, which often contain technical jargon. The importance of legal translation in this industry includes:

  • Service contracts that need to be understood by users in various countries to ensure compliance with local laws and regulations.
  • Regulatory filings that must be submitted in multiple languages to meet the requirements of different national authorities.

Legal translation presents unique challenges that require specialized skills and knowledge. Given that legal systems and terminologies can vary dramatically between jurisdictions, translators must navigate a complex landscape to ensure accuracy and maintain the integrity of legal documents. Understanding these challenges and implementing best practices can significantly enhance the quality of legal translations.One of the primary challenges in legal translation is the existence of terminology differences and cultural nuances.

Legal terms often do not have direct equivalents in other languages, which can lead to misinterpretations. Additionally, legal systems are influenced by the cultural context in which they exist, resulting in practices and terminologies that may not be universally understood. Failure to accurately translate these nuances can have serious implications in legal contexts.

Common Challenges in Legal Translation

Several key challenges affect the quality of legal translations. Recognizing these issues is critical for translators and legal professionals alike. The following points highlight common challenges faced in this field:

  • Terminology Variability: Legal jargon can differ from one jurisdiction to another, making it difficult to find appropriate translations that convey the correct legal meaning.
  • Cultural Differences: Legal concepts may be interpreted differently across cultures, leading to miscommunication if these differences are not appropriately considered.
  • Complex Sentence Structures: Legal documents often employ complex legal language that can be challenging to translate accurately while retaining the original meaning.
  • High Stakes: The consequences of inaccuracies in legal translations can be severe, potentially affecting legal outcomes or causing financial losses.

Best Practices for Quality and Accuracy

To overcome the challenges inherent in legal translation, several best practices can be applied. Adhering to these practices can significantly improve translation outcomes and enhance the collaboration between translators and legal professionals. Here are some best practices to consider:

  • Use of Specialized Translation Tools: Employ translation memory systems and glossaries specific to legal terminology to ensure consistency and accuracy across documents.
  • Collaboration with Legal Experts: Working closely with legal professionals helps translators understand the context, purpose, and implications of the legal documents they are translating.
  • Thorough Research: Conduct comprehensive research on the relevant legal systems, terminologies, and cultural contexts to better prepare for translation tasks.
  • Quality Assurance Processes: Implement robust proofreading and review processes to catch potential errors and ensure the final translation is polished and accurate.

Collaboration between Translators and Legal Professionals

The partnership between translators and legal professionals is essential for effective legal translation. This collaboration enables translators to gain insights into the legal context, which is crucial for providing accurate translations that reflect the intended meaning of the original documents. Open lines of communication facilitate a better understanding of nuanced terms and specific legal implications, leading to more reliable outcomes.

Step Description
1. Initial Consultation Discuss the project requirements, document types, and specific legal contexts.
2. Research and Preparation Conduct thorough research on the legal terminology and relevant cultural contexts.
3. Translation Translate the document while ensuring fidelity to the original legal meanings and context.
4. Review and Proofreading Perform a detailed review of the translated text to identify and correct any inaccuracies.
5. Final Approval Obtain approval from legal professionals to ensure the translation meets all legal standards.
